Public Prosecutor Lekha throws a curveball that threatens Mukul’s future: she formally proposes that the boy be tried as an adult. This strategic move escalates the case from a reform-focused juvenile matter to a potentially life-altering criminal trial. Web of Lies:

Following Mukul's arrest, his desperate mother Avantika (Swastika Mukherjee) and stepfather Neeraj (Purab Kohli) manage to hire Madhav Mishra. However, Mukul is a cynical, defiant teenager. He is completely unimpressed by Mishra’s unpolished attire, humble demeanor, and lack of corporate luster. This creates an immediate friction between the lawyer and his hostile young client. 2. : Denied his freedom, Mukul is sent back to the juvenile correctional home where the environment turns hostile. He is targeted, beaten, and thrown into a water tank by an inmate gang leader named Rocky.

The legal stakes skyrocket when Prosecutor Lekha uses the escalating media frenzy to propose a motion under . She intends to prosecute the 17-year-old Mukul as an adult, which would expose him to life imprisonment rather than rehabilitation. 4. Techniques and Craft The episode employs tight, focused direction and editing to sustain suspense. Dialogue-driven scenes co-exist with quieter, visual moments—lingering shots of domestic spaces, personal effects, and empty rooms—that imply histories and emotional absence. The use of close-ups captures micro-expressions that betray unspoken tensions, while scene transitions often mirror the fracturing of the narrative truth. Sound design and a restrained score accentuate moments of revelation and introspection instead of relying on melodrama.
